#c5bfb2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c5bfb2 is composed of 77.3% red, 74.9%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 41.1 degrees, a saturation of 14.1% and a lightness of 73.5%. #c5bfb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8b7f65.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#c5bfb2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c5bfb2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0bdb7 is the less saturated color, while #fed479 is the most saturated one.
